Fleeceware is a type of malware mobile application that come with hidden, excessive subscription fees. [1] These applications also take advantage of users who do not know how to cancel a subscription to keep charging them long after they have deleted the application. [1]

Malden Mills Industries is the original developer and manufacturer of Polartec polar fleece and manufactures other modern textiles. The company is located in Andover, Massachusetts and has operations in Hudson, New Hampshire .
